WHAT DOES AN EVENT PLANNER DO?

We work with you, months or even years in advance to plan and structure your event. We’re all about the logistics, from vendor referrals and contract negotiation to site plans and mood boards. We make planning your event as seamless as possible; keeping track of who’s doing what, when and how- what they need to do the job, what it costs, and tackling changes as they come up (and they will).
We also offer design services- from helping hone the overall aesthetic, to planning the creative specifics that all come together for a cohesive atmosphere. We ask the questions you don't think to ask, we know tricks to make things work in a pinch, we handle a ridiculous amount of emails, texts and phone calls, and we aren't afraid to get our hands dirty.

WHAT DOES A MONTH-OF COORDINATOR DO?

Rather than do any original planning, a Month-Of Coordinator is responsible for making sure the vision and scheme are executed properly. We may not make the seating plan, but we will make sure that your caterer has the correct menu selections and final guest count- that you don’t forget the easels or frames for your signage - and that your place cards are numbered correctly & placed in the proper spot. We’ll also identify any discrepancies in the original plans, address items that may not have been thought of, and basically connect all the dots that you’ve put into place.
Day-of, we are the primary point of contact for the venue, all vendors, your wedding party and YOU- the client. We are the manager on duty, overseeing vendors' work and making sure they do their jobs according to what was contracted. We address logistical items, unexpected situations, and questions in general that may arise.

MY VENUE HAS A COORDINATOR, SO I DON'T NEED A WEDDING COORDINATOR.

Actually... you probably do. A Venue Coordinator is NOT the same as a Wedding or Event Coordinator. Simply put, the Venue Coordinator only manages things related to the VENUE (i.e. vendor guidelines, accessibility, arrival times, parking, etc.)
A Wedding / Event Coordinator manages EVERYTHING surrounding your special event!
